  7. There does not have to be contact for it to be a foul. The wording of the law is 'trip or attempt to trip'. Having said that, you would normally only give a foul if the offended player had found it necessary to take evasive action from the swinging leg and thereby had lost possession, or maybe stumbled.

We used to have Child Tax Allowance (along with mortgage interest tax relief) and a separate Family Allowance but there were arguments that the tax allowance went to the father to spend on fags and beer and ought to go direct to the mother so it was all changed. You're right to suggest that the whole system is in dire need of simplification.
